Bush Hog Mowing in Prince Georges County, MD
Bush Hog mowing services involve the use of heavy-duty rotary cutters to clear overgrown grass, weeds, and brush from large or uneven areas. This service is suitable for maintaining fields, pastures, vacant lots, or properties with extensive grassy spaces that require more than regular lawn mowing. Property owners typically request Bush Hog mowing to restore overgrown areas, prepare land for future use, or manage difficult-to-maintain terrains, especially when standard mowers are insufficient for the job.
Before requesting Bush Hog mowing, property owners should consider the size and terrain of the area, as well as any obstacles such as trees, fences, or structures that may impact access or safety. It is also helpful to communicate the desired level of clearing and whether any debris removal is needed afterward. Understanding these details ensures the service can be tailored to meet specific property needs and land conditions effectively.

Common Bush Hog Mowing Jobs
Field clearing - removing overgrown grass and weeds from large open areas.
Brush removal - clearing thick brush and small trees to improve property access.
Pasture mowing - maintaining grass levels for grazing animals or agricultural use.
Fence line trimming - keeping grass and weeds down along property boundaries.
Roadside mowing - trimming grass along driveways, entrances, and rural roads.
Trail maintenance - keeping walking and riding paths clear and accessible.
Bush Hog Mowing Questions
What is Bush Hog mowing? Bush Hog mowing involves using heavy-duty rotary cutters to trim thick grass, brush, and overgrown areas on a property.
What types of properties benefit from Bush Hog mowing? This service is ideal for large fields, overgrown lots, pasture clearing, and properties with dense vegetation.
Is Bush Hog mowing suitable for uneven terrain? Yes, it is effective on rough or uneven land, helping to clear and maintain difficult-to-access areas.
What should property owners consider before scheduling Bush Hog mowing? It’s important to remove debris and ensure access to the area to allow for safe and efficient operation.
